A New Intrusion Detection Model Based on Artificial Immune Algorithm

Jian Liao , Zhi Li and Zhimin Li
Hunan Mechanical & Electrical Polytechnic, Hunan, Changsha 410151, China.

ABSTRACT

This paper introduces artificial immune to intrusion detection system through the analysis of the similarity of artificial immune and intrusion detection and puts forward a model of intrusion detection system based on artificial immune distributed agent. Firstly the system model structure is introduced and a hierarchical structure of intelligent agent is presented as well as a dynamic evolution model. At the same time a kind of vaccine immunization algorithm is put forward and network risk evaluation operator is given to evaluate real-time network security situation. This algorithm can keep the diversity of antibodies, and simultaneously has high convergence speed. The experimental results show that the proposed model has the feature of real-time processing that provides a good solution for heterogeneous fleet high-speed network environment.
